Search
Near Me
Local Guides
About
US
Indianapolis
Crossroads Eyecare
Crossroads Eyecare
C
Crossroads Eyecare
(on 96th)
Eye doctors & Optometrists in Indianapolis, IN
Eye doctors & Optometrists
Contact Us
Make a call
317-576-9809
Website
Hours
Monday
9:00AM - 4:00PM
Tuesday
9:00AM - 4:00PM
Wednesday
11:00AM - 7:00PM
Thursday
11:00AM - 7:00PM
Friday
9:00AM - 4:00PM
Saturday
Closed
Sunday
Closed
Location
6905 E 96Th St
Indianapolis, IN
46250
Information
Company name
Crossroads Eyecare
Category
Eye doctors & Optometrists
FAQs
What is the phone number for Crossroads Eyecare in Indianapolis IN?
You can reach them at: 317-576-9809. It’s best to call Crossroads Eyecare during business hours.
What is the address for Crossroads Eyecare on 96th in Indianapolis?
Crossroads Eyecare is located at this address: 6905 E 96Th St Indianapolis, IN 46250.
What are Crossroads Eyecare(Indianapolis, IN) store hours?
Crossroads Eyecare store hours are as follows: Mon-Tue: 9:00AM - 4:00PM, Wed-Thu: 11:00AM - 7:00PM, Fri: 9:00AM - 4:00PM, Sat-Sun: Closed.
Nearby
TLC Laser Eye Centers
5875 Castle Creek Parkway North, Indianapolis
1.3 miles
MyEyeDr.
7840 E. 96th Street, Fishers
1.3 miles
Allisonville Eye Care Center
10967 Allisonville Rd, Fishers
1.3 miles
LensCrafters at Macy's
6020 E. 82nd Street, Indianapolis
1.4 miles
Drs. Christopher Emmons and Michael Fagin
6020 E. 82nd Street, Indianapolis
1.4 miles
LensCrafters
6020 E 82nd St, Indianapolis
1.5 miles